Rainer Abart is a scholar working on Geophysics, Geochemistry and Petrology and Materials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Rainer Abart has authored 154 papers receiving a total of 2.8k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 101 papers in Geophysics, 28 papers in Geochemistry and Petrology and 24 papers in Materials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Rainer Abart’s work include Geological and Geochemical Analysis (93 papers), High-pressure geophysics and materials (56 papers) and earthquake and tectonic studies (29 papers). Rainer Abart is often cited by papers focused on Geological and Geochemical Analysis (93 papers), High-pressure geophysics and materials (56 papers) and earthquake and tectonic studies (29 papers). Rainer Abart collaborates with scholars based in Austria, Germany and Switzerland. Rainer Abart's co-authors include Christian de Capitani, Gerlinde Habler, Elena Petrishcheva, Dieter Rhede, Fred Gaidies, Lukas M. Keller, Richard Wirth, M. Horacek, Ralf Schuster and Ralf Milke and has published in prestigious journals such as The Journal of Chemical Physics, Geochimica et Cosmochimica Acta and Acta Materialia.
